> Heck, it's Friday...
>
> If we have parent device for several GPIO devices, this won't work right now
> due to limitations of fwnode regarding to the sturct device.
>
> So, it means we may not have shared primary with different secondary fwnodes.
>
> So, come back to the initial suggestion (overwrite it for now):
>
>         /*
>          * If custom fwnode provided, use it. Currently we may not
>          * handle the case where shared primary node has different
>          * secondary ones. Ideally we have to use
>          * set_secondary_fwnode() here.
>          */
>         if (gc->fwnode)
>                 device_set_node(&gdev->dev, gc->fwnode);
>

Other parts of gpiolib-of depend on the of_node being there.
Converting it to fwnode is a whole other task so for now I suggest we
just convert the fwnode to of_node in struct gpio_chip as per my
patch.
